Virtualiseren van een SBS 2003
Onlangs heb ik het uitgevoerd. Ik heb een Dell Server met een OEM SBS 2003.
Deze heb ik omgezet naar een Hyper-V server met SBS 2003 gevirtualiseerd.
De situatie:
- Een Dell PowerEdge 1430 met Xeon 4 core en 8 Gb intern geheugen; Twee harddisks 145Gb + 450 Gb geen raid. OEM SBS 2003.
- De wens om deze server wat intensiever te kunnen gebruiken.
Doel:
- Een server met Hyper-V2008R2 met daarop draaiende de SBS2003 server en een W2008R2 webserver en een W2008R2 TFS server.
- Zo min mogelijk werk om dit te bereiken.
Hoe heb ik dit uitgevoerd?
- Ik ben gestart met een extra harddisk te installeren en deze als bootdisk ingesteld.
- Vervolgens hierop Hyper-V 2008 R2 geinstalleerd. Gewoon de gratis versie, te
downloaden op: http://www.microsoft.com/en-us/server-cloud/hyper-v-server/default.aspx
- De installatie duurt wel eventjes - een 1,5 uur - maar je hoeft er niet bij
te zijn.
- Vervolgens de Hyper-V manager mmc installeren op mijn Windows 7 werkstation.
Je kunt deze software downloaden via: http://blogs.technet.com/b/virtualization/archive/2008/03/25/hyper-v-manager-mmc-now-available.aspx
- Vervolgens kwam het eerste probleem: De Hyper-V manager installeren op mijn
Windows 7 werkstation is niet moeilijk, maar om deze verbinding te laten maken
met de Hyper-V server is een ander paar mouwen! Dit werkte niet out-of-the-Microsoft-box. Maar gelukkig zijn er al héél véél
sites over volgeschreven.
De beste voor mij was de site van John Howard met zijn hvremote-tool: http://blogs.technet.com/b/jhoward/archive/2008/11/14/configure-hyper-v-remote-management-in-seconds.aspx. Even goed doorlezen en aandachtig opvolgen en het gaat hiermee zeker lukken.
- Na een uurtje was het me gelukt om de Hyper-V manager te laten communiceren
met Hyper-V server. Vervolgens was het zaak om van de SBS2003 schijf een
gevirtualiseerde disk te maken: een VHD bestand.
- Ook hier zijn goede tools voor. De beste is die van Sysinternals. Het
eenvoudige programmaatje van slechts 800 kb is te downloaden op: http://technet.microsoft.com/en-us/sysinternals/ee656415 Dit programma draaide ik vanaf mijn Windows 7 werkstation. Ik converteerde
de gehele D-drive van de Hyper-V server (\\hypervr2\d$ -- mijn SBS 2003 bootdisk) naar de Hyper-V server C-drive (\\hypervR2\c$\hypervDisks\DC01.VHD). Het duurde wel even, maar een goede 4 uur later was het klaar.
- Vervolgens met de Hyper-V mmc een nieuwe virtuele server aangemaakt met het bestand c:\hypervdisks\dc01.VHD als disk. Raadpleeg hiervoor de uitgebreide Hyper-V documentatie op de Microsoft site
- Toen ik de SBS 2003 server eindelijk opstartte, mopperde deze meteen omdat de hardware gewijzigd was en wilde opnieuw geactiveerd worden! Omdat de netwerkkaart nog niet goed werkte en ik niet verder in Windows geraakt dan het activatiescherm, heb ik deze gewoon telefonisch geactiveerd.
- Vervolgens was het nog maar een fluitje van een cent. De Hyper-V drivers installeren, wat instellingen aanpassen en de SBS2003 draaide perfect
- Wel nog een tip: geef de SBS2003 maar één virtuele processor. Meer dan een veroorzaakt alleen maar last en de processor blijft continu op circa 12% activiteit draaien!
- Daarna nog een nieuwe W2008R2 server op Hyper-V geinstalleerd en mijn gewenste configuratie was klaar!
Zaterdagochtend om 9.00 uur begonnen en 's avonds om 9.00 uur klaar. Hierin zat dan zo'n 6,5 uur installatietijd (het Windows balkje), het in- en uitbouwen van de server/serverdisks, wat pauzes en andere werkzaamheden.
Echt iets om aan te raden op een regenachtige zaterdag en je fysieke server biedt ineens veel meer mogelijkheden.
Succes!